Saw this with Walter Yesterday. Quite possibly the funniest move so far this year. The funniest thing is that a lot of the scenes were setup so the people in them really though that Borat was a Kazak news guy. I read up a little on it. It seems most of the movie was actual reactions from people which makes it even funnier. I got the feeling the whole time that there's no way this was done in a studio. The people's reactions were so genuine.
